SSA Adapter Device Driver Direct Call Entry Point
Purpose
To allow another kernel extension to send transactions to the SSA adapter device
driver. This function is not valid for a user process. When the function completes its run,
an off-level interrupt notifies the caller. See SSA_GET_ENTRY_POINT SSA adapter
ioctl operation.
Description
The entry point address is the address that is returned in EntryPoint by the
SSA_GET_ENTRY_POINT ioctl operation. The function takes a single parameter of
type SSA_Ioreq_t, which is defined in the /usr/include/sys/ssa.h file.
The fields of the SSA_Ioreq_t structure are used as follows:
SsaDPB
An array of size SSA_DPB_SIZE, which is used by the SSA adapter device
driver, and should be initialized to all NULLs.
SsaNotify
The address of the function in the SSA head device driver that the SSA
adapter device driver calls when the directive has completed.
u0
The transaction to be executed. Valid transactions are described in the
Technical Reference for the adapter.
Return Values
This function does not return errors. You can determine success or failure of the
directive by examining the directive status byte and transaction result fields, which are
set up in the SSA MCB. For details, see the Technical Reference for the adapter.
Chapter 13. Using the Programming Interface
265
Содержание Advanced SerialRAID Adapters SA33-3285-02
Страница 1: ...Advanced SerialRAID Adapters User s Guide and Maintenance Information SA33 3285 02 ...
Страница 2: ......
Страница 3: ...Advanced SerialRAID Adapters User s Guide and Maintenance Information SA33 3285 02 ...
Страница 16: ...xiv User s Guide and Maintenance Information ...
Страница 18: ...xvi User s Guide and Maintenance Information ...
Страница 21: ...Part 1 User Information 1 ...
Страница 22: ...2 User s Guide and Maintenance Information ...
Страница 48: ...28 User s Guide and Maintenance Information ...
Страница 64: ...44 User s Guide and Maintenance Information ...
Страница 76: ...56 User s Guide and Maintenance Information ...
Страница 212: ...192 User s Guide and Maintenance Information ...
Страница 228: ...208 User s Guide and Maintenance Information ...
Страница 230: ...210 User s Guide and Maintenance Information ...
Страница 254: ...234 User s Guide and Maintenance Information ...
Страница 274: ...254 User s Guide and Maintenance Information ...
Страница 330: ...310 User s Guide and Maintenance Information ...
Страница 331: ...Part 2 Maintenance Information 311 ...
Страница 332: ...312 User s Guide and Maintenance Information ...
Страница 338: ...318 User s Guide and Maintenance Information ...
Страница 430: ...410 User s Guide and Maintenance Information ...
Страница 503: ...Part 3 Appendixes 483 ...
Страница 504: ...484 User s Guide and Maintenance Information ...
Страница 508: ...488 User s Guide and Maintenance Information ...
Страница 529: ......
Страница 530: ...Part Number 27H0678 Printed in the U S A SA33 3285 02 1P P N 27H0678 ...
Страница 531: ...Spine information Advanced SerialRAID Adapters User s Guide and Maintenance Information ...